My Night-Out Makeup


When it comes to going out and choosing makeup, I stick to what I know. There's nothing worse than 'trying out a new look' right before you're about to go out and hating it and then having to quickly rush and re-do your face. This had happened on my birthday. Never again. Therefore I've found my staple night-out makeup bits that I know won't fail me. 

For the base I like more of a full-coverage foundation, so I opt for the L'Oreal True Match Foundation. I love this stuff as it makes my skin look flawless in photos and gives it a bit more dimension that a regular matte foundation. It stays in place and is just a perfect canvas. For that extra coverage I use the Collection Lasting Perfection Concealer on any spots and my dark under-eyes as it's just a faultless product. For bronzer I tend to go in with my Benefit Hoola Bronzer as I can do a bit more of a harsh and defined contour which I like for a night out, along with the Benefit Rockateur Blush as it tends to work with nearly every eyeshadow look. 

Highlighter of course is a definite must on a night out. During the day I like to go subtle with my highlight, opting for either theBalms Mary Lou but I tend to go for more of a bam highlighter and chose my Sleek Solstice Palette and use my favourite shade Equinox to highlight my cheeks, bridge of my nose and my cupids bow. 

Onto the eyes I know that I can always count on my Charlotte Tilbury Dolce Vita Palette to create a smokey bronze/copper eyelook. To highlight my brow bone I love going in with the shade 'hemisphere' from the Sleek palette as well, as it's beautiful to lift and add more glam to your look.  I always wear eyeliner and my favourite is the L'Oreal SuperLiner SuperStar. I can easily create a small winged liner that is even and actually fully opaque. I don't wear falsies as I find they look really odd on me, plus I don't have the patience but I do like big voluminous lashes, so I always wear my Maybelline Lash Sensation Mascara for length and volume. 

Bold lips are a definite no, no for me. It's hard enough for me to not get red lipstick all over my shirt and face when I'm sober, let alone after a few vodka oranges. Therefore it's best I go for a very neutral shade and mostly opt for Charlotte Tilbury Pillow Talk as it's really 'my lips but better/plumper'. 

Finally I have to set my makeup so a couple spritz of the Urban Decay All Nighter Setting Spray ensures that my makeup sits in place for the entire evening!
